3. Operation

The following commands can be used to display current configuration status and various help menus:

View Modem Setup:

ATI4

Basic Help Menu:

AT$

Dial Command Help Menu:

ATD$

Configuration Command Help Menu:

AT&$

List of S-Registers:

ATS$

Reset Modem to Default Profile 0:

ATZ3

When the View Modem Setup command (ATI4) is invoked, the RMM will display a status screen as shown below.
